Branch Office
33 Traveler St, Boston, MA 02118-2231
(617) 469-2089
We Are Here
Truck Renting & Leasing in Boston, Massachusetts
Rental Service Stores & Yards in MA 02118
Rental Service Stores & Yards in Boston, Massachusetts
Branch Office
33 Traveler St, Boston, MA 02118-2231
(617) 469-2089
Copyright © 2025 WebForCompany.com. All rights reserved.